So glad you both are hanging in there. I don't know how long Senekot takes, I think all of the softner and laxatives act differently in everyone. Like ksdm said, no food for 10 days, probably not much poop to push out. If you are uncomfortable with the progress, you might ask for an X-ray of Lisa's abdomen. They can bring the X-ray to her room and know in minutes what is happening in her bowels; lots of air, free or pockets, where and how much fecal matter, is it semi solid or liquidy?
